Blue Green Algae Bio Fertilizers Market Set for Strong Sustainable Growth

The global agriculture industry is increasingly shifting toward sustainable and environmentally responsible farming practices. Growing concerns about soil degradation, excessive chemical fertilizer use, nutrient runoff, and long-term agricultural productivity are encouraging farmers to explore biological alternatives. Blue-green algae bio fertilizers are emerging as an important solution because they can support soil fertility and crop development while aligning with the broader movement toward sustainable agriculture.

According to Market Research Future, the Blue Green Algae Bio Fertilizers Market was valued at approximately USD 2.501 billion in 2024 and is projected to increase from USD 2.867 billion in 2025 to USD 11.24 billion by 2035. The market is expected to register a CAGR of 14.64% during 2025–2035, highlighting the growing commercial potential of algae-based agricultural inputs.

Product Innovation Creates New Opportunities

Innovation in product formulation is expected to play an important role in the development of the blue-green algae bio fertilizers industry. According to MRFR, the market includes liquid, granular, and powdered bio fertilizer forms, providing manufacturers with opportunities to address different agricultural requirements. Granular bio fertilizers are identified as a rapidly growing segment because of their ease of application.

Companies are also working toward improving formulation stability, application efficiency, and product performance. Better formulations can help overcome some of the practical challenges associated with biological agricultural inputs and encourage greater farmer acceptance.

Seed Treatment and Crop Applications

Application technology is another important area of market development. Blue-green algae bio fertilizers can be used through soil application, foliar application, and seed treatment. Seed treatment is expected to become increasingly important as agricultural producers focus on efficient input utilization and early-stage crop development.

The market also covers cereals and grains, fruits and vegetables, pulses and oilseeds, and turf and ornamentals. This broad application base provides opportunities for manufacturers to develop specialized products for different crops and cultivation environments.

Asia-Pacific Offers Significant Growth Potential

Regional expansion is expected to remain an important factor in the industry’s development. MRFR identifies North America as the largest market, while Asia-Pacific is emerging as the fastest-growing region. Increasing awareness of environmentally friendly agricultural products and expanding sustainable farming practices are supporting demand across developing agricultural economies.

The growing agricultural sector in Asia-Pacific could create opportunities for manufacturers to expand distribution networks, develop region-specific formulations, and collaborate with agricultural organizations and technology providers.

Challenges and Future Opportunities

Despite strong growth potential, the industry faces challenges including differences in product performance across agricultural conditions, limited awareness among some farmers, storage requirements, and the need for appropriate application practices. Education and farmer training can therefore become important components of market expansion.

Companies that invest in research, product development, farmer education, and efficient distribution networks can strengthen their competitive position. Partnerships with agricultural technology companies may also help integrate biological fertilizers with precision farming and data-driven crop management.
